Adding a Bulb to a JK Tail Light - Bright Enough?

OK, we plan on flat towing our 2015 JK. I'm thought I had decided to add bulb to each tail light using something like the RM-155 Road Master kit. But then I read a couple of reviews that said the tail light was not very bright due to where you had to mount the bulb. Anyone use that method? Are the tail lights sufficiently bright?

    It's a plug and play harness for your '15 JK. We and many, many others on here have installed that kit and it works flawlessly. It utilizes your stock tail lights, brake and turn lights. When those are used, the bulbs for them are mounted directly in front of the reflectors that are built into the tail light housing. That's the best and most safest way to do what you want to do. It's a piece of cake to install. Any questions about, PM me and I'd be glad to help.

    We've been running that kit in our '15 JKUR for about 8 months now and it's great.
